Highland Park to add luxury mid-rise homes

According to the Dallas Business Journal a three-story project, named The Ravello, will be built by Sharif & Munir, along with Gray & Co. Realtors, Inc., on Lomo Alto Drive in Highland Park.

The project will consist of six residences, two on each floor, with an average 4,800 square feet per unit, priced from $3.75 million.

A private elevator, three parking spaces in a gated underground garage and private storage will be part of the deal.

Each homeowner will have an opportunity to create a custom home designed to their exact specifications.
